D. Blondin is a scholar working on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, D. Blondin has authored 117 papers receiving a total of 3.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 55 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, 52 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 25 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in D. Blondin’s work include MRI in cancer diagnosis (41 papers),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(30 papers) and Advanced MRI Techniques and Applications (23 papers). D. Blondin is often cited by papers focused on MRI in cancer diagnosis (41 papers),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(30 papers) and Advanced MRI Techniques and Applications (23 papers). D. Blondin coll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Switzerland. D. Blondin's co-authors include Gerald Antoch, Rotem S. Lanzman, Michael Quentin, Christian Arsov, Peter Albers, Robert Rabenalt, Lars Schimmöller, Hans‐Jörg Wittsack, Patric Kröpil and Andreas Hiester and has published in prestigious journals such as The Lancet, Journal of Clinical Oncology and Notes and Queries.
